(حديث مرفوع) حَدَّثَنَا
م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 جَعْفَرٍ ، حَدَّثَنَا
شُعْبَةُ ، عَنْ
أَيُّوبَ ، عَنْ
عَطَاءٍ ، أَنَّهُ شَهِدَ عَلَى
ابْنِ عَبَّاسٍ ، وَابْنُ عَبَّاسٍ شَهِدَ عَلَى رَسُولِ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 أَنَّهُ " صَلَّى فِي يَوْمِ عِيدٍ ، ثُمَّ خَطَبَ ، ثُمَّ أَتَى النِّسَاءَ فَأَمَرَهُنَّ بِالصَّدَقَةِ ، فَجَعَلْنَ يُلْقِينَ " .
It is narrated from Sayyiduna Ibn Abbas (may Allah be pleased with them both) that I bear witness regarding the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) that he led the prayer before the sermon on the day of Eid, then delivered the sermon, then went to the women and admonished and advised them, and instructed them to give charity, upon which the women began to give charity (by taking off their earrings and rings).
